The B.S. in Physics Returns to Sonoma State University!

Sonoma State University is proud to re-launch its Bachelor of Science in Physics, featuring a redesigned, student-centered curriculum available beginning Fall 2026. The revised program offers a rigorous physics foundation, small class sizes, close faculty mentorship, and flexible pathways that support timely graduation. Black Holes: The Science Behind the Science Fiction

Dr. Eliot Quataert
University of California at Berkeley

Darwin 103
3:00 PM

Dr. Eliot Quataert of the University of California at Berkeley  will describe what black holes are, how they are discovered, and how they give rise to some of the most energetic and remarkable phenomena in the universe.
